The strongest Obligation that lies on all Men to speak or write nothing but the Truth, is Conscience; And the sense that all Men are supposed to have of the natural Turpitude of a Lye, is the chief ground of that very great Credit that we give to humane Testimony in Cases of the greatest Concern and Consequence. 2.
